Early Times Report
Jammu, Apr 8: Verma Gharana paid rich tribute to “Pt. Krishan Lal Verma”, an eminent Tabla Maestro by organizing a programme at Abhinav Theatre to highlight the deeds and achievements of Sh. Krishan Lal Verma in the field of Music, Art and Languages. The event was organized by his son Mr. Neeraj Verma who is a reputed Tabla artist. Sh. Ghulam Abbas (IIS), Director, Central Bureau of Communication, J&K and Ladakh under the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, Government of India was the Chief Guest of the programme. Speaking on the occasion, Sh Abbas stated that the best tribute to artists is to take forward their legacy through young generation. He said artists never die but they live forever through their art Dr. Anupriya Sachar, daughter-in-law of Sh. K.L. Verma, conducted proceedings of the event. She read out a detailed paper on the life and work of Sh. K. L. Verma. The programme began with various disciples (Vasu Partap Singh, Samdeep Singh, Sehajdeep Singh, Aditya Saraf and Adhiraj) of Mr. Neeraj Verma, a renowned Tabla Maestro of J&K followed by a Vocal Recital by Vidushi Jasmeet Kour (Prof., GCW Parade).
